Cameras for Drones
Small cameras for drones need to be able to support high-resolution images while at the same time making the aircraft smaller.
KEL’s micro coaxial cables are highly flexible and can support high-speed transmission characteristics while keeping the connector part ultra-compact to achieve high image quality.

GPS Modules, Navigation Systems, Sensors
With each new generation, drones become smaller while incorporating more sensors and instruments, making their boards increasingly densely populated with components.
KEL’s micro coaxial cable connectors use hair-thin cables that can be freely routed inside a drone’s small chassis. If our floating connectors are used, the floating mechanism absorbs mounting tolerances and can withstand shocks such as dropping.

8900 Series
1.27 mm pitch connector/Low-profile type
The 8900 Series is a 1.27 mm pitch, low-profile, board-to-board connector. Straight and right angle types are available. The straight type has five variations of height ranging from 7 mm to 12 mm. It is also available with or without a metal hook.

FAS Series
1.5 mm pitch drawer connector
“FAS series” is a 1.5mm pitch drawer connector. Like the FA series, this product meets the requirements for drawer connectors: prevention of pin buckling, ease of mating adjustment, stress reduction during mating, and high connection reliability.
A sufficient floating mechanism (maximum ±1.4mm in XY directions) is provided to reduce stress after mating. In addition, in order to take advantage of this, the amount of induction is increased to ±3mm in the XY direction. Furthermore, we have created a structure in which the contacts do not come into contact when being guided, but only come into contact after the connectors are straight, which buckling prevention. The contact concept uses a two-point contact with a contact sandwich, which has a proven track record in our GF series battery connectors. Highly reliable connection has been achieved by setting effective mating length to 3.4mm. The cable is a cable crimp type that is compatible with AWG #24 to 28 discrete cables. With a wide variety number of contacts ranging from a minimum of 4 to a maximum of 40 pins, this product can meet a wide range of needs. The standard product has a mating/unmating durability of 2,000 times, and multiple mating/unmating types are also available, so please contact us for details. (When mating FAS01/FAS12: 7,000 times. When mating FAS01/FAS11: 5,000 times.) The FAS series is smaller than the FA series from a 2.5mm pitch to a 1.5mm pitch, and one of its major features is that it saves more than 30% of the printed circuit board space it occupies.
